📝 Walkthrough

Walkthrough

This PR upgrades devcontainer features (Node -> node:2, adds aws-cli, removes pnpm mount), normalizes Go module sync comments to use relative paths, and adds a new AWS SAM–based jobs subsystem including build/deploy Makefile, SAM template, Go Lambda handler, and supporting configs/docs.

Changes

Development Environment & AWS Lambda Jobs Setup

Layer / File(s) Summary
Dev Container Feature Updates
.devcontainer/devcontainer.json, .devcontainer/devcontainer-lock.json
Dev container moved to ghcr.io/devcontainers/features/node:2 (Node v25), added aws-cli:1, removed mount-pnpm-store, ensured Python feature is 3.12 with installTools: false, and updated lockfile metadata.
Build System Path Normalization
Dockerfile, Dockerfile.cli, Makefile, cli/go.mod, pkg/go.mod, server/src/go.mod
Sync comments changed from absolute /workspace/server/src/go.mod to relative server/src/go.mod; Makefile comment updated to include devcontainer Node feature.
Lambda Build and Deployment Configuration
jobs/Makefile, jobs/.gitignore, jobs/go.mod, jobs/requirements.txt, jobs/samconfig.toml, jobs/README.md
Adds Makefile targets to build and package Lambda bootstrap binaries, install Python deps, deploy via SAM with SSM-sourced parameters; includes module manifest, SAM config, requirements, gitignore, and README.
Lambda Infrastructure Template and SMTP Handler
jobs/template.yaml, jobs/functions/hello-world/main.go
Adds SAM template defining globals, VPC, and HelloWorldFunction; Go Lambda reads SMTP_USER/SMTP_PASS, opens TLS SMTP connection, authenticates, and sends a fixed "Hello World" email.

jobs/functions/hello-world/main.go (1)

17-17: ⚡ Quick win

Avoid hardcoding a real recipient address in source.

Make the recipient configurable (env var or parameter) to prevent accidental sends and improve portability across environments.

Suggested change
 const (
@@
-	toAddress    = "ataylor@directactioneverywhere.com"
 	fromAddress  = "tech-noreply@directactioneverywhere.com"
@@
 )
@@
 	user := os.Getenv("SMTP_USER")
 	pass := os.Getenv("SMTP_PASS")
+	toAddress := os.Getenv("SMTP_TO_ADDRESS")
-	if user == "" || pass == "" {
-		return "", fmt.Errorf("SMTP_USER and SMTP_PASS must be set")
+	if user == "" || pass == "" || toAddress == "" {
+		return "", fmt.Errorf("SMTP_USER, SMTP_PASS, and SMTP_TO_ADDRESS must be set")
 	}

🧹 Nitpick comments (2)
jobs/README.md (2)

18-27: ⚡ Quick win

Add minimum AWS CLI version requirement for aws login.

The aws login command requires AWS CLI version 2.32.0 or later. Add a note documenting this requirement so users don't encounter unexpected failures with older CLI versions.

📝 Suggested addition
 Log in with the AWS CLI:
 
 ```bash
 aws login

-Note: the above command works for IAM users, not SSO / Identity Center users,
+Note: aws login requires AWS CLI version 2.32.0 or later. It works for IAM users, not SSO / Identity Center users,
and uses your console credentials rather than storing a long term IAM access
key. You must re-run it every time your console session expires.
